Day Two| October 20th | Horseback riding in Jarabacoa
It’s time to head to the mountains! We’ll drive to Jarabacoa and settle into our eco-lodge nestled in the heart of the “Dominican Alps”. Jarabacoa is known as “the land of eternal spring” because of its temperate climate and fertile land. A great portion of the agriculture of the Dominican Republic finds its home here. After a typical Dominican lunch at our eco lodge, we’ll ride horses to Salto Baiguate, an 82 foot waterfall surrounded by nature. The ride will take us through lush vegetation, tropical surroundings and villages where we can see some aspects of Dominican culture. After taking a refreshing bath at the Baiguate Waterfall, pass by La Melaza and enjoy some fresh fruit smoothies at this great local spot.

Day Three | October 21st | White water rafting at Yaque del Norte
After breakfast at the lodge, we’ll hop on a raft and ride down the cool waters of the Yaque del Norte, the longest river in the Caribbean. In the company of professional guides, we will go through canyons and rapids while enjoying breathtaking views. Feel the excitement as you go down some of the most impressive rapids in the country!

Day Four | October 22nd | Waterfalls and Beaches
Now that we’ve had a chance to spend time in the mountains, we’ll head down to the north coast after breakfast. Get ready to enjoy an adventure packed day! This area is known for its majestic coast and gorgeous beaches. Stop along the way to take advantage of 27 Charcos, a collection of waterfalls that we can jump, slide, and rappel down. Have lunch near the waterfalls before continuing our journey to the beach town of Cabarete, famous for windsurfing. Settle into your hotel right on the coast for a peaceful evening.
